Lake Superior College Electrician Training Program Highlights

  • Comprehensive Curriculum: Covers residential, commercial, and industrial electrical systems, including wiring, conduit bending, motor controls, and programmable logic controllers (PLCs). Expect training in both theory and hands-on application.
  • Hands-on Training: The program emphasizes practical skills development through extensive lab work and real-world simulations. Expect dedicated lab spaces equipped with industry-standard tools and equipment.
  • Industry-Recognized Certifications: The program likely prepares students to take industry-recognized certifications, such as the Registered Unlicensed Electrician exam in Minnesota or other relevant certifications like OSHA safety training. This increases employability.
  • Strong Emphasis on Safety: Safety is paramount in the electrical field. The program likely integrates extensive training in electrical safety procedures, including lockout/tagout, personal protective equipment (PPE), and National Electrical Code (NEC) requirements.
  • Career Opportunities: Graduates are prepared for entry-level positions as electricians in residential, commercial, and industrial settings. Career paths might include becoming a journeyman electrician, master electrician, or electrical contractor.
